Huddersfield General Election 2019 results in full

The voters of Huddersfield have been braving the the wind and the rain at the polls to elect their MP in the 2019 General Election.

And now the waiting is over for Almondbury, Ashbrow, Dalton, Greenhead, and Newsome.

The seat of Huddersfield has a new Member of Parliament.

Before this year's election, the sitting MP was Labour's Barry Sheerman.

Polls closed across the UK at 10pm on December 12, and a count has been underway ever since.

The 2019 results are below:

New MP is Labour Barry Sheerman.

Breakdown:

Labour: Barry Sheerman - 20,509

Conservative: Ken Davy - 15,572

Liberal Democrat: James Wilkinson - 2,367

Green: Andrew Cooper - 1,768

The Brexit Party: Stuart Hale - 1,666
